titleOfInvention Pathogen-resistant coatings
abstract A pathogen-resistant coating 305 comprising one or more photocatalysts 310 capable of generating singlet oxygen from ambient air. The pathogen-resistant coating may optionally include one or more singlet oxygen traps 320.
